厘清AI伦理评估与系统风险的关联,推动全面评价体系构建

过去十年间,围绕AI系统社会与伦理影响的评估体系不断涌现,主要依据高层级伦理原则构建。然而这些评估方法分散使用,缺乏对实际系统结构的关注。本文基于涵盖近800项指标的系统性文献综述,分析其与11项AI伦理原则的对应关系。发现多数指标集中于公平性、透明性、隐私与信任四类原则,且主要针对模型或输出组件。极少考虑系统各要素间的交互作用,每种伤害类型所覆盖的风险范围也极为有限。许多评估指标与伤害发生位置脱节,且缺乏设定合理阈值的指导。这表明当前评估仍处于碎片化状态,仅孤立测量局部环节,未能捕捉伤害在系统中的动态演化过程。将评估措施与系统属性、潜在风险及实际伤害相联结,有助于加强监管、推动产业落地,并为未来研究提供系统性基础。

Over the past decade, an ecosystem of measures has emerged to evaluate the social and ethical implications of AI systems, largely shaped by high-level ethics principles. These measures are developed and used in fragmented ways, without adequate attention to how they are situated in AI systems. In this paper, we examine how existing measures used in the computing literature map to AI system components, attributes, hazards, and harms. Our analysis draws on a scoping review resulting in nearly 800 measures corresponding to 11 AI ethics principles. We find that most measures focus on four principles - fairness, transparency, privacy, and trust - and primarily assess model or output system components. Few measures account for interactions across system elements, and only a narrow set of hazards is typically considered for each harm type. Many measures are disconnected from where harm is experienced and lack guidance for setting meaningful thresholds. These patterns reveal how current evaluation practices remain fragmented, measuring in pieces rather than capturing how harms emerge across systems. Framing measures with respect to system attributes, hazards, and harms can strengthen regulatory oversight, support actionable practices in industry, and ground future research in systems-level understanding.
